Netron:数据可视化助力模型理解与优化

作者:渣渣辉2023.10.07 22:26浏览量:10

简介:Netron 模型可视化神器,保存好的模型丢进去就能可视化!

Netron 模型可视化神器,保存好的模型丢进去就能可视化!
随着人工智能领域的快速发展,模型训练和测试变得越来越复杂。在这个过程中,模型的可视化显得尤为重要。它可以帮助我们更好地理解模型的内部结构和行为,进一步优化模型的性能。今天,我们要介绍的是一款备受推崇的模型可视化神器——Netron。它将带领你走进模型的世界,让你看到前所未见的细节与美!
Netron 是一款功能强大的模型可视化工具,它支持多种深度学习框架,如TensorFlowPyTorch、Keras等。Netron 的特点是简单易用、高效便捷,即使是非专业人士也能快速上手。通过 Netron,你可以轻松地查看模型的架构、参数、训练曲线等信息,让你对模型了如指掌。
使用Netron 非常简单,只需遵循以下步骤:

  1. 安装Netron:你可以从官方网站下载 Netron 的安装包,或者使用 pip 进行安装。安装完成后,启动 Netron,你会看到一个简洁明了的界面。
  2. 加载模型:在 Netron 中,选择“File”菜单,然后选择“Open Model”选项。接下来,选择你要可视化的模型文件(支持多种格式),Netron 将自动解析并加载模型。
  3. 可视化模型:在模型加载完成后,Netron 会自动打开可视化界面。在这个界面中,你可以查看模型的详细信息,包括架构、参数、训练曲线等。你还可以通过三维图形展示模型的结构,让你更加直观地了解模型的内部情况。
  4. 导出图像:如果你想把可视化结果保存下来,可以选择“File”菜单中的“Export Image”选项。Netron 会将当前的可视化结果保存为一张高质量的图像文件,方便你后续的查阅和分享。
    在使用 Netron 的过程中,有几个需要注意的问题:
  5. 模型文件的格式:在加载模型时,确保你的模型文件是支持的格式。Netron 支持常见的深度学习模型格式,如SavedModel、HDF5、TorchScript等。
  6. 安全性:在使用 Netron 时,要确保你的计算机环境安全可靠,避免加载未知来源的模型文件,以免受到恶意代码的攻击。
  7. 可视化效果:虽然 Netron 的可视化效果已经非常出色,但不同模型的展示效果可能会有所差异。对于一些特殊的模型结构,Netron 可能无法完全展示出来。这时,你可以尝试调整可视化参数或者使用其他工具进行查看。
    让我们来看一个实例演示,如何使用 Netron 来可视化一个保存好的 TensorFlow 模型:
  8. 首先,安装 Netron 并打开软件。
  9. 在“File”菜单中选择“Open Model”选项,然后找到你要可视化的 TensorFlow 模型文件(.pb或.h5)。
  10. Netron 将自动解析并加载模型。这时,你可以在左侧的模型结构树中查看模型的架构。
  11. 在右侧的属性面板中,你可以查看模型的详细信息,如参数数量、优化器等。
  12. 点击可视化界面的“Export Image”选项,将当前的可视化结果保存为一张图像文件。
    在这个实例中,我们看到了如何使用 Netron 来可视化一个保存好的 TensorFlow 模型。通过这个演示,你可以更加直观地了解 Netron 的使用方法和可视化效果。
    总之,Netron 是一款强大实用的模型可视化神器,它能够让你快速可视化保存好的模型,并且支持多种深度学习框架。使用 Netron 可以帮助你更好地理解模型的内部结构和行为,从而优化模型的性能。由于其简单易用、高效便捷的特点